The winery also expands its consumer experience with new tastings at its Napa Valley estate

Napa, CA, August 15, 2018Luna Vineyards is the latest of a curated selection of wineries to open a tasting room in The Village, a new space bringing together the best of Napa’s Wine Country.  Open 11 am until 7 pm daily, the Luna Vineyards tasting room at The Village offers four unique varietals hand-selected from our Estate and Reserve collection for consumers to taste.   

“We here at Luna Vineyards are so honored to be able to share our special wines with new consumers who are frequenting The Village,” said Andre Crisp, President  & CEO of Luna Vineyards.  “We pride ourselves on creating unique and innovative wine tastings to elevate our consumers’ experience and interaction with our wines, and we have done so with new tastings at our winery’s estate.”

Leading with their popular Pinot Grigio Reserve and Sangiovese Classico (both internationally recognized and highly rated by respected publications and reviewers), have shown much success for the winery in The Village and their tastings at the winery. Luna Vineyards recently implemented new, intimate tasting experiences at their Napa Valley estate. This includes an Estate Tasting, a personalized, sit-down tasting featuring a selection of current release Napa Valley and estate-grown wines, and a Private Tour and Tower Tasting, an intimate experience that starts with a welcome glass of wine in the estate vineyard, continues with a tour of the wine cellar, and finishes in the private tower where guests enjoy the view of the vineyard from above while tasting a flight of current releases and reserve wine selections. The winery also has new hours of operation, opening at 9:30 am and closing at 5 pm, ideal for the Tour and Tower tastings which start in the morning.   

Shawna Miller, the winemaker at Luna Vineyards, came up with these tasting formats and decided on the varietals and vintage to be showcased. Her winemaking has resulted in a 95 gold rating for Luna’s 2015 Petit Verdot and 2014 Merlot from Decanter in its prestigious 2018 World Wine Awards, all of which can be tasted at the winery and will be featured at the Decanter Fine Wine Encounter from Nov 3-4.

About Luna Vineyards:

Luna Vineyards’ pioneering roots began in Napa Valley over two decades ago, as the first along the Silverado Trail to plant Pinot Grigio. Today, the winery is still dedicated to innovation – creating uniquely balanced wines crafted to accompany a wide variety of foods and occasions.
